Russia CUTS electricity to Finland: Moscow-run state energy company says it will stop supplying Helsinki tomorrow over ‘payment issues’
Russia will suspend electricity supplies to Finland this weekend, a supplier said on Friday as tensions rise over Helsinki’s NATO bid amid Moscow’s military campaign in Ukraine.
‘We are forced to suspend the electricity import starting from May 14,’ said RAO Nordic, a subsidiary of Russian state energy holding Inter RAO.
RAO Nordic is not able to make payments for the imported electricity from Russia.’
